Is Your Mobile Battery Pack Legit?
When you invest in a laptop power bank, you're hoping for reliable performance. Unfortunately, the market is filled with copyright and low-quality options. So how do you determine if your power bank is the real deal?
Here are some warning signs:
- Ridiculously cheap prices: If a deal seems too good to be true, it probably is.
- Flimsy build quality: Inspect the power bank for rough edges.
- Missing or generic branding and marks: Legitimate brands feature their name and logo.
- Conflicting information: Pay attention to the model number, specifications, and features listed on the power bank itself. Any discrepancies could indicate a copyright product.
Before you commit, do your homework. Check online reviews, compare prices from reputable sellers, and look for certifications to ensure you're getting a legitimate power bank.
